## Quick Start
Minimal working example:
```yaml
# prometheus.yml
global:
scrape_interval: 15s
evaluation_interval: 15s
external_labels:
monitor: "infrastructure-monitor"
environment: "production"
# Alertmanager configuration
alerting:
alertmanagers:
- static_configs:
- targets:
- localhost:9093
# Rule files
rule_files:
- "alerts.yml"
- "rules.yml"
scrape_configs:
# Prometheus itself
- job_name: "prometheus"
static_configs:
- targets: ["localhost:9090"]
// ... (see reference guides for full implementation)
```
